Ada-Europe is an international organization dedicated to promoting Ada programming. Its goal is to promote Ada’s use and understanding, as well as its adoption into academic and scientific institutions. Ada-primary Europe’s goal is to advocate European interests in Ada and Ada-related issues.
Ada-Europe was founded in 1988 in its current form. It was founded under Belgian law because there is no European legislative framework to manage such entities. Ada-Belgium, Ada-Denmark, Ada-Deutschland, Ada-France, Ada-Spain, and Ada-Switzerland are the current member organizations.
Individual members of these organizations can join Ada-Europe as indirect members. Individuals from nations without a national member organization can join directly. Ada-Europe currently has over 300 members across all membership levels.
Ada-Europe is led by a Board that is chosen at the annual Ada-Europe General Assembly.
International Conference on Reliable Software Technologies (AEiC) 2022
The 26th Ada-Europe International Conference on Reliable Software Technologies (AEiC 2022) will be held in dual-mode in Ghent, Belgium, with a strong focus on in-person events and digital assistance for remote participation. A journal track, an industrial track, a work-in-progress track, a vendor display, parallel tutorials, and satellite workshops are all on the conference agenda.

- Journal-track submissions highlight scientific advancements that are backed up by a strong theoretical framework and a comprehensive review.
- WiP-track entries depict a fresh research concept that is still in the early stages of development, anywhere between conception and the first prototype.
- Submissions on the industrial track focus on the practitioners’ perspective on a difficult case study or industrial project.
- Attendees are guided through a hands-on familiarization with revolutionary advances or beneficial features connected to crucial software in tutorial submissions.
